## Configuration

Tilecrumb's cache layer sits between the renderer and object storage, so most knobs live in `.env` rather than code. Set `TILECRUMB_CACHE_DIR` to a disk with room to breathe (raster tiles add up fast), and `TILECRUMB_TTL_HOURS` to whatever your map refresh cadence is — 24 is fine for most setups. Eviction runs in-process, no cron needed. Cache entries are HMAC-signed so a tampered tile never gets served. Right below these settings, add the line that sets the signing key.

env line for fafof-fahag: LEDGER_TOKEN5=f8790

Dependency pinning on the Mistvale API follows a strict lockfile policy: every third-party package is pinned to an exact version, and upgrades land only through the weekly `pindrift` report reviewed at eng sync. Transitive dependencies are resolved once and frozen; floating ranges are rejected by CI. To pull the current lock manifest from the Mistvale registry for audit, call the `/v2/lockfile` endpoint and authenticate with this bearer token:

portal login ticket: eyJhbGciOiJIUzI1NiIsInR5cCI6IkpXVCJ9.eyJzdWIiOiIwEOsktwVNwIn0.-UJU3fdyyCgG

## Tuning

Partitionly splits host tables by calendar month. Plugins must never write directly to a partition; route everything through the dispatcher, which resolves the target from the row timestamp. Pre-creation of future partitions and pruning of expired ones run on a shared maintenance worker, so aggressive settings in your plugin affect every tenant on the host. Override only via the documented config surface — raw SQL against partition metadata voids support. Defaults ship as these constants:

tuning table, faduf-baduf:
PRIORITIES = {
    "ulavan": 191,
    "silys": 750,
    "goriel": 238,
    "kelmir": 66,
    "wendor": 432,
}

## Authentication

The nightly reindex job (we call it Owlsweep) rebuilds the search index for Findery around 02:30. Support folks: if customers report stale search results in the morning, the usual culprit is Owlsweep failing its login to the internal Shelfgate indexer — not the index itself. You can check the run status in the Burrow dashboard without any credentials. The job itself, though, needs to authenticate, and it does so with the key just below.

API key for yahig-tadup: kto7_ubizbYm